Amazon's Major Investment in Louisiana

Amazon has announced plans to invest $12 billion to develop artificial intelligence data centers in Louisiana.

The new campuses will be located in the Caddo and Bossier Parishes in northwestern Louisiana. This investment is part of Amazon's larger strategy to expand its data center capabilities to support AI and cloud computing initiatives.

Job Creation and Economic Impact

The company expects the development of these data centers to create 540 full-time jobs.

Additionally, around 1,700 other roles will be supported, including positions for electricians, HVAC technicians, and security specialists. This job creation is seen as a positive economic boost for the local communities.

Amazon's Capital Expenditures for 2026

Amazon's total capital expenditures for the year 2026 are projected to reach $200 billion. This figure is notably higher than the combined forecast of nearly $700 billion from other major tech companies, known as hyperscalers.

This significant spending is primarily focused on AI-related projects, including data centers, chips, and networking equipment.

Partnership and Infrastructure Investments

To develop the data centers, Amazon is collaborating with Stack Infrastructure.

The company has also committed to investing up to $400 million in public water infrastructure to support the campus. Amazon has pledged to use only surplus water from the surrounding area, ensuring that local water supplies are not strained.

Challenges and Community Concerns

Despite the investment's potential benefits, local communities have expressed concerns about the environmental impact of data centers.

Residents have noted that these facilities can place a strain on electricity and water resources. In the past, Microsoft faced backlash in Wisconsin, leading them to abandon a planned data center site due to similar concerns.

In response to these challenges, Amazon stated that it worked closely with the local utility, Southwestern Electric Power Company, to ensure they cover all costs associated with the campus, including upgrades to energy infrastructure.

The company also plans to utilize natural air for cooling the data centers whenever possible to reduce electricity demand.

Wall Street's Response to Amazon's Spending Plans

Amazon's ambitious spending plans have faced skepticism from Wall Street. Following its February 5 earnings report, the company's shares fell for nine consecutive days, resulting in a loss of over $450 billion in market value.
